First post. This is absolutely terrifying. I'm posting mostly because I've found it helpful to read about others' accounts.

"No result" from Harmony test (first attempt). Nuchal test on Friday, came up with 1:4 for T21, and 1:6 for T13/T18. CVS scheduled for Monday afternoon. [If anyone is interested in the basis for the 1:4 result: Papp-A and beta HCG both very, very low; NT at what I think is the high end of normal (2.1); and tricuspid regurgitation...on the plus side, baby has weirdly long legs, and nasal bone present, and is otherwise structurally normal.]

Do I need to do anything to prepare for CVS? Do they scan you again before doing the CVS?
